Spring Boot development patterns and idioms tailored for Kotlin applications.
Works with
Use primary constructors for dependency injection, data class for DTOs, and the kotlin-jpa plugin to automatically open entity classes without boilerplate.
Organize code by feature/domain rather than layer; leverage Kotlin's null-safety to clearly define optional vs. required entity fields.
Apply @ConfigurationProperties with data class for type-safe, immutable configuration; use application.yml and Spring
